Joyful Sadhana chants to welcome the new day! Gentle, clear and easy-to-meditate-with musical renditions of Kundalini Yoga morning mantras in subtle, contemporary, folk guitar-choral arrangements.
Resound Unto Infinity With Gurutrang!
EVERY word spoken by a man is called 'mantra'. Mantra means mental vibration. Ta-ra means trang. Trang means resound. Whatever resounds unto Infinity is called trang. -Yogi Bhajan, September 6, 1989
Yoga Morning's magnificent mantras were recommended by Yogi Bhajan for daily practice and deep stress reduction during the challenging 21-year cusp of the Aquarian Age, June 21st 1992 through 2014. Gurutrang means Master of Good Vibrations and in 1975, Yogi Bhajan told Gurutrang Singh, You will become a renowned musician. However, because he never personally recorded any of his music until 1999, very few people in 3HO actually knew how prolific he really was. But it was he who in fact wrote the 3HO standards like Sat Nam The Grace Within You and Oh Guru Ram Das Thank You For This Beautiful Day first recorded by The Khalsa String Band in 1973. He went on to write the very funny Yogi Tea Song which has been featured in Putumayo World Music radio commercials nationwide. He also became notoriously legendary at Winter Solstice Celebrations in Orlando, Florida for his witty sadhana wake up ditty, Get Out of Bed You Little Sleepy Head. All four of these songs were featured tracks on the CD One In The Spirit - 30 Years of 3HO Music released by the Healthy, Happy, Holy Organization in 1999.
Gurutrang Singh has created and played many unique musical renditions of Yogi Bhajan's recommended morning meditation chants live for sadhana at his 3HO home ashram in Herndon, Virginia for years.
Gurutrang Singh Khalsa who is a Doctor of Chiropractic and Acupuncture, maintaining a busy practice in Herndon, Virginia and living happily in the ashram with his French, flower-designing, yoga-teaching wife Gurumata Kaur Khalsa and his vastly talented, entertaining and engaging young son, Shabd Singh Khalsa.
